Hospital Reports Encouraging Signs for Juan Cruz Yacopini After Diving Accident

Doctors now report spontaneous breathing after reduced sedation, with the prognosis still guarded.

Overview

  • He remains in intensive care at the Clínica de Cuyo under a reserved prognosis as specialists monitor a serious cervical medullary injury at C1–C2.
  • Sunday’s medical bulletin said he was lucid after sedation was decreased and could breathe without ventilator support.
  • The 26-year-old sustained severe head and spinal trauma after diving into shallow water at Dique El Carrizal on Friday.
  • During transfer he suffered a cardiorespiratory arrest and was resuscitated by emergency personnel before moving from Hospital Perrupato to the Clínica de Cuyo.
  • Toyota Gazoo Racing South Africa confirmed he will not race the 2026 Dakar Rally, with any surgical decisions pending reduced spinal inflammation and further evaluation.
